Hebron's pest activity is shaped by movement. Properties near Buckeye Lake, Newark, Heath, and Kirkersville may deal with traffic from I-70, lake visitors, restaurants, convenience stops, rentals, and older village housing. Cockroaches are most likely where food handling, drains, deliveries, and storage rooms provide steady opportunities. Mice can use garage gaps and utility penetrations around homes, while ants often follow damp foundation edges, patio cracks, and kitchen access. Hebron differs from nearby Granville because the pest picture is less campus-residential and more tied to highway service, lake-season turnover, and practical building access.
Water and occupancy patterns add another layer. Mosquitoes can become noticeable around low spots, containers, and shaded yards influenced by Buckeye Lake drainage. Seasonal rentals or homes with frequent guests may also see pests introduced through luggage, furnishings, or supplies. Termite inspection is important where decks, porch supports, or crawl spaces hold moisture. Terminix can inspect Hebron properties by looking at door use, trash handling, basement humidity, outdoor storage, and whether the site changes character during lake season. The best service plan accounts for repeated introductions as well as pests that are already established on the property.
Bio-rational materials can support a Hebron pest plan when they are matched to the source of activity. A lake-area rental, a food-service business, and a year-round home may require different treatment placement and prevention steps. Terminix may use environmentally mindful options where appropriate, but inspection should guide the decision. Reducing standing water, sealing access points, improving storage, and tightening sanitation routines help selective materials work better and reduce the need for unnecessary broad application.
